So if you get #1 on tdc (#4 tappets rocking, or "on the rock") Install the distributor so that the rotor will point to just after #1 position inside the cap (just after for advance) If it doesn't, remove the distributor and rotate the gear/shaft until when it is installed it points to the above described position (As this rotor spins anti-clockwise then it would be to the left of the caps #1 position) Then as firing order is 1-2-4-3, then this is the order that the HT leads will be plugged in to the cap working anti-clockwise from 1
